At Newton-le-Willows train station, you will find a ticket office that operates extensive hours, opening as early as 6 a.m. and closing just before midnight. There are also user-friendly ticket machines that accommodate both cash and card payments, ensuring a smooth ticket purchasing experience. The station caters to the needs of all travelers with smartcard validators and an induction loop.
For those needing assistance, staff help is available, and customer help points are strategically placed around the station. Though there is no luggage storage option, CCTV cameras are present for enhanced security. Accessibility features include step-free access throughout the station, a scooter-friendly environment, and ramps for train access. However, facilities such as waiting rooms and seating areas are not available. Additionally, there are 32 dedicated accessible parking spaces within the 400-space car park operated by Merseytravel, offering free parking.
Conveniently, the station is linked with various transportation modes. There's a handy bus interchange outside the station's booking office on Alfred Street for those needing to catch a rail replacement service or general bus services. For a more personalized trip, taxis can be booked online at Cab4You. Although bicycle hire is not offered, the facilities are supportive of cycling enthusiasts, providing 24 sheltered bike storage spaces equipped with CCTV surveillance.

Although Steeton & Silsden station is unstaffed, it thoughtfully caters to passengers with essential services. While there's no ticket office, travelers can conveniently collect their pre-purchased tickets from one of the available ticket machines. These machines, however, are not accessible, so if you have specific needs, assistance should be arranged in advance. The station supports smartcards, which provides a modern, seamless way to validate your journey. The presence of CCTV ensures a sense of safety, even if you’re simply passing through to catch your train.

Accessibility features at Steeton & Silsden ensure that traveling is as inclusive as possible. Though the station is categorized as having partial step-free access, a considerate layout allows passengers needing step-free routes to access platforms effectively, albeit with some limitations. For additional assistance, travelers are encouraged to utilize the 0800 helpline or find support upon arrival using the help points located throughout the station. The facility to book assistance up to two hours before your journey means help is close at hand when needed.
Getting to and from Steeton & Silsden is straightforward, with various transport options available. Although there's no direct underground or metro connection, local buses and taxis provide a seamless journey to your final destination. Buses pick up from the stop at the bottom of Station Road, while taxis can be booked online. To make life a touch easier, rail replacement services are conveniently accessible during any planned maintenance work on your intended rail routes.
Wi-Fi isn't available on site, but payphones are accessible for essential communications. Cycling enthusiasts will be pleased by the bicycle storage facilities, which include stands, lockers, and CCTV protection to secure your ride while you travel. Car drivers can avail themselves of the station's 143-space car park that operates 24/7 and is free of charge, though it should be noted that there are no dedicated accessible parking spaces available.
